How to split sensible and latent cooling loads

Cooling load divides into sensible heat, which changes air temperature, and latent heat, which removes moisture. The ratio between them, the sensible heat ratio, decides the supply air temperature the coil has to deliver and whether reheat is needed. Sizing equipment from a total BTU/hr figure alone is how rooms end up cold and clammy at the same time, so this calculator reports occupants, lighting and equipment, and outdoor air as separate sensible and latent streams.

Occupant heat gains come straight from the ASHRAE Fundamentals table of activity levels: 245 BTU/hr sensible and 205 latent per person for seated office work, rising to 580 sensible and 920 latent for heavy factory work, where the latent share dominates. Outdoor air load uses the standard US shortcut constants, Qs = 1.08 × CFM × ΔT and Ql = 0.68 × CFM × ΔW in grains per pound. Both constants assume standard air at 0.075 lb/ft³: 1.08 comes from 60 × 0.075 × 0.24, and 0.68 from 60 × 0.075 × 1,061 ÷ 7,000.

Lighting and plug loads are entered in watts and converted at 3.412 BTU/hr per watt, and all of it is treated as sensible gain. Required capacity is expressed in US refrigeration tons at 12,000 BTU/hr per ton. Envelope conduction and solar gain through glass are not included here, so add a separate envelope calculation to the sensible total and have a mechanical engineer review the result before equipment is selected.

Frequently asked questions

What does a low sensible heat ratio mean?

It means dehumidification dominates. Below about 0.70 you generally need a colder coil leaving-air temperature, reheat, or dedicated dehumidification to hold the space humidity setpoint.

Why are envelope and solar gains left out?

This tool covers internal gains and ventilation air. Envelope loads need orientation, glazing performance and shading coefficients, so calculate them separately and add the result to the sensible total.
